The EU-MERCOSUR Free Trade negotiations were launched by the end of 1995, more than 20 years ago. The stop and go pattern reached a high go point in 2004 when both the EU and the then 4 Mercosur countries (Argentina, Brazil, Paraguay and Uruguay) got very close to concluding the deal.
